After hurricane, Patterson city government waives some fees

From William Gil of the Patterson city government:

For the next 60 days, starting from September 16, 2024, the city will waive permitting fees related to storm damage. However, homeowners, business owners, and contractors are still required to obtain the necessary permits to ensure the work is performed correctly
and safely.

Proper Permits Still Required: Owners and contractors must still secure the proper work permits.

Some Key Points to Remember:

Permitting Fees Waived: For 60 days, fees for storm damage-related permits are waived.

Licensed Contractors: All work must be done by a properly licensed tradesperson using compliant materials.

Contracts and Insurance: Contractors are required to provide a written contract and proof of insurance before starting any work.

Licensing Requirements: Contractors must be licensed by the appropriate State Boards. Plumbers and natural gas fitters need licenses from two different State Boards.

Local Licensing and Tax Documentation: Contractors may also need to secure local licenses and provide the necessary tax documentation.
